Israel considers expelling British and European officials from Int'l Gaza Support Center – report
The International Gaza Support Center is a multinational headquarters established to monitor the US-brokered ceasefire between Israel and Hamas.
Israel is reportedly considering expelling British officials, and potentially other European representatives, from the US-led International Gaza Support Center. According to the Financial Times, the Israeli government has discussed removing the UK from this multinational headquarters, which was established to monitor the US-brokered ceasefire between Israel and Hamas. Reuters has not yet independently verified this report.
